Easy to take care of

French Bulldogs, or "Frenchies," as they're affectionately known are now among the most sought-after breeds of dogs in recent years. Their good-natured temperament and charming looks make them perfect companions for people of all different ages. Like any breed they require special attention to stay healthy and happy. Regular exercise is necessary to keep the muscles of these dogs strong. They also require regular grooming and dental care. They are friendly and enjoy being the center of attention.

They are ideal apartment pets since they don't require much space and love to spend time on the couch. They usually are a good companion for children and other pets, but should be carefully introduced to young kids in order to prevent accidental injuries. Similarly, they may not be able to handle rough play, especially from larger, more rambunctious dogs. Additionally, their brachycephalic nature makes them poor swimmers and must be kept out of bodies of water.

It is also important to pay attention to their skin folds. If they are not kept clean, a condition known as skin fold dermatitis could develop. You can prevent this from happening by cleaning your neck and face with a moist cloth or a medicated wipes frequently. Additionally, you should give them baths every two or three months and use a mild soap to keep their skin healthy.

In addition to maintaining their coats, Frenchies need regular nail trims and dental cleaning. They're more susceptible to developing gum disease which is why brushing them regularly and having them cleaned at the vet when needed can help avoid this. They are also more likely to be afflicted with ear infections as compared to other breeds, so cleaning them regularly and examining for symptoms of ear infections regularly is essential.

Frenchies can also gain weight easily. It is essential to keep an an eye on their diet and take them on short walks to prevent overexertion. In addition, you should keep them out of hot weather as much as you can, as they could overheat easily. Affectionate

Frenchies are known for their love for people and their jolly personalities. They are great companions for families and are great with children. They can be a bit clingy and sometimes suffer from separation anxiety however, with proper training and cautious introductions, they can be comfortable with other pets at home. They are not good guard dogs and can be injured by large or fast moving animals.

Like their name suggests, Frenchies are not only smushed faces and bat ears; they have huge hearts full of affection for their humans. This affection can be expressed in a variety ways including enthusiastic greetings and cuddles that are sleepy. The "Frenchie Lean" is a way to show their love for you. They will melt into your body, and will hold you close.

Frenchies are mellow, easy-going and affectionate dogs. They don't bark and will only do so in the event of danger or if their owners' safety is in danger. They are great companions for apartment dwellers or other urbanites seeking an animal companion that is easy to manage and carry without feeling weak.

While they're sleeping on the couch or chasing their favorite ball around the house, Frenchies will always be with you. They "Velcro" puppies are at their best when they're with their human and it's not uncommon to see them following their owner from room to room. This isn't a sign of aggression, but rather a sign that they are loyal to their owners and never leave. If you're not able to spend time with your Frenchie frequently, you might want to consider another breed of dog. While they are able to adapt to different kinds of lifestyles, they aren't ideal for very active lifestyles or extreme humid or hot weather. They are brachycephalic, which means that they have breathing problems and tend to be sensitive to extreme temperatures. This is why they must be kept indoors as long as possible. Low-maintenance

French Bulldogs require minimal exercise and grooming. They love being indoors and enjoy being lap dogs. These playful dogs can entertain and delight their owners by clowning around with them. They are happy to relax and sit. They don't bark too much and rarely become aggressive.

They are very social and get along well with cats, dogs and children. Although they can be a bit cautious with strangers, Frenchies are usually friendly and welcoming towards guests. They can be in a home with other pets, however they are not suitable for a home with small animals due to their size and instincts to protect food and belongings. They also do not take temperatures well which is why they should be kept inside in hot weather.

Frenchies as well as other dogs with short faces, may suffer from back issues such as intervertebral disc disease. To avoid this, do not over-exercise them or allow them to be outside for long durations of time. They are also not swimming well and should be kept away from pools and ponds. They can also develop an eye condition known as entropion, where the eyes roll inwards, which can cause irritation to their corneas. This is a genetic condition that can lead blindness, however it can be treated with surgery.
